Top 48 Sap Idt Interview Questions
Q1. What Do You Understand By Custom Hierarchies?
They are used to carry out custom drill down on gadgets from identical or one of a kind instructions in Universe. To create a Custom hierarchy, go to Tools → Hierarchies.
Q2. What Is An Alias Table And Why Do We Use It In Universe?
An Alias desk is referred to as connection with a popular table in Data Foundation. The facts in Alias table is completely identical because the original desk.
Alias tables are used to break loops in Join path in Data Foundation layer. An Alias desk can also be used to rename a table.
Q3. What Is The Use Of Query Panel?
You can use query panel to create or preview queries on a Business Layer or at the pinnacle of Universe published in repository.
Query panel allows you to add items within the question and to preview the question outcomes.
Q4. What Is Docking/undocking Concept In Dashboard Designer?
It is also possible to transport item browser, components browser, Query browser and houses panel from the default locations. To dock a factor, you need to click on on pinnacle of panel and drag it to docking icon. To move a aspect, you have to first dispose of auto hiding.
Q5. How You Can Access A Derived Table From Other Derived Table?
By the usage of derived table function
@derived_table(Derived Table Name)
Q6. What Is The Difference Between Udt And Idt?
In UDT, Universe are created with record extension as .Unv. In IDT, Universe file extension is modified to .Unx report.
To open unv file in IDT, it may’t be immediately opened but you could convert unv file to unx document to open in Information Design tool.
You can’t open an IDT .Unx document in Universe Design tool nor you could convert it to unv document.
Universe Design tool is unmarried supply enabled but IDT is multi supply enabled way you may extract the statistics from extraordinary statistics sources whilst developing a Universe.
Universe Design Tool (UDT)
Universe report extension - .Unv
You can’t open .Unx file and also it could’t be transformed to unv to open in UDT
It is unmarried supply enabled
It can’t be without delay connected to Dashboard clothier and Crystal Reports present day model
Information Design Tool (IDT)
Universe document extension - .Unx
You can open unv fileby changing unv document to unx report extension
It is multisource enabled
It can be immediately related to Dashboard fashion designer and Crystal Reports modern day version
Q7. When You Use An Olap Connection To Build A Business Layer, What Happens To Objects?
Objects within the business layer are inserted mechanically primarily based on the dice. You can upload below functions to beautify features in Business Layer −
Using analytical dimensions, hierarchies, and attributes.
Named sets
Calculated individuals
Insert measures
Pre-defined filters (obligatory or non-compulsory) to restrict statistics lower back in queries
Parameters with non-compulsory prompts
Lists of values to be related to a prompt
Q8. If You Want To Set Notifications For Data Values If They Are In Acceptable Limit Or Needs Some Attention?
Alerts are used to set notifications for data values, if values are suitable or require interest. To permit indicators, click on the check container.
You can set Alert Thresholds, allow auto colour, and so forth.
Q9. What Is Aggregate Awareness? How Do You Use This?
Using mixture cognizance, you can use pre-aggregated statistics in tables in the database. It is used to enhance question overall performance with the aid of processing much less variety of rows.
When you upload an aggregate aware object in question, query generator retrieves the statistics from desk with highest aggregation stage.
Example −
Consider a Sales Fact desk in which income is aggregated through in keeping with month. If your query asks for income consistent with month, question generator will retrieve the facts from aggregated desk.
Q10. How Do You Convert Unv File To Unx File?
Using UMT Upgrade Management furnished with BI 4 for prior releases or in IDT you can do an instantaneous conversion.
Q11. What Do You Understand By Resource Dependency In Universe?
In a Universe there may be many objects that are dependent on every different and shifting, deleting a resource can impact different sources that relies upon on that useful resource.
To take a look at the dependency among different resources, you could pick out show neighborhood dependency.
Q12. What Are The Options Under Component Browser?
Category
List
Tree
Q13. What Is A Derived Table And Why Do You Use It?
A derived desk is a virtual desk in the records basis that mixes different tables using calculations and features.
You can use derived tables for below motive −
To create a desk with columns from different tables. The column definitions can include complex calculations and features.
To create a single table that mixes or more tables.
To create a table that includes a selection of columns from distinct tables.
To Insert Derived desk, Select table header → right click → Insert → Derived desk.
Q14. What Are The Default Template Categories In Dashboard Data Model?
To create new models, you may use template as starting point. Template additionally offers an concept how one-of-a-kind thing works and you could upload them to canvas to construct a brand new version.
It shows you list of template beneath that class.
Q15. Is It Possible To Set Dashboard To Refresh After A Specific Time Period? How?
When you upload objects the usage of a question, you have got alternatives to select −
Refresh before components are loaded
Refresh each time length
Q16. How Do You Hardcore Values In A Data Model In Dashboard?
By manually coming into values in cells in Spreadsheet after which binding those cells to factor label and values under Properties.
Q17. What Is Selector Component? What Are The Different Types Of Selector Component?
Selector factor allows customers to pick out specific alternatives at run time. Selector can be used to configure item’s row, price, position and label into embedded spreadsheet.
You can add selectors from Component browser in Dashboard fashion designer.
Check container
Combo box
Filter
Q18. What Are The Different Output Formats In Dashboard?
Power factor
Word
Attach in email
Q19. Where Can You Define Color Setting For A Component In Data Model? What Ae The Options In Color Dialog Box?
You can set shade for each detail of a aspect in data model. Colors can be described in Appearance tab underneath Properties pane.
There are extensive variety of colours to be had and you could additionally create your own custom colours.
To outline colour for every detail, choose the element → Go to Color Selector for each element. You can select below sections in color dialog box −
Theme Color : To define colour of modern subject matter.
Standard Color: These are institution of simple colorations.
Recent Color: This indicates recently used hues.
Q20. What Is The Use Of Single Value Component? What Are The Different Styles Of Single Value Component?
Single value additives are used for adding interactivity to statistics models. You can use them to feature more interest to essential parameters.
Single value additives may be utilized in different styles −
Horizontal Progress Bar
Vertical Progress Bar
Dual Slider
Dual Slider 2
Dial
Q21. What Is The Data Foundation And Business Layer In Idt?
Business Layer −
This layers contain all the training and objects, you can take a look at dimensions and measures which are defined in a Universe.
When you put up the commercial enterprise layer in repository, this suggests the of completion of Universe introduction.
You can check the summary of Business Layer to peer wide variety of attributes, dimensions, measures, instructions, LOV’s and so forth.
Data Foundation Layer −
This layer is used to define records foundation - includes tables from records source, joins, and keys etc.
Q22. What Is Web Connectivity Components? What Are The Different Component Types?
These additives can help you join your data model to net. Apart from this, you can also use facts supervisor to configure net connectivity.
URL button: When user clicks at run time, a button links to a relative or absolute URL.
Reporting Service Button: This allows you to connect to reporting offerings server and pick out a file to apply in statistics version.
Slide Show: This allows you to create a slide display of URL based pix and SWF files.
SWL loader: This lets in you to load SWF documents from a URL and also you don’t should import the files. It is much like slide display aspect however it gives better reminiscence management.
Connection Refresh Button: This lets in user to refresh the connection manually whilst you hyperlink to it.
Q23. What Is The Use Of Sap Bo Dashboard?
Dashboards dressmaker is SAP Business Objects facts visualization device this is used to create interactive dashboards from unique information assets. Dashboard dressmaker lets in BI builders to create custom dashboards and evaluation that meet the business requirement in an corporation.
Dashboards can include one-of-a-kind graphs, charts and gauge which might be based on the records supplied by facts sources. Dashboards are used by Senior Management that offers updated statistics to statistics to organisation CEO’s and VP’s.
Q24. If You Are Using An Olap Data Sources, Do You Need To Create A Data Foundation?
No, enterprise layer reads the structure of the OLAP source robotically.
Q25. What Is Difference Between A Relational And An Olap Connection?
The idea is basically if you need to get entry to information from a table and ordinary RDBMS then your connection have to be a relational connection but in case your source is an software and records is stored in dice (multidimensional like Info cubes, Information fashions) then you could use an OLAP connection.
Relational connection can simplest be created in IDT/UDT.
OLAP may be created in each IDT and CMC.
Another component to observe is relational connection (which includes HANA) will continually produce a SQL declaration to be fired from file whilst OLAP connection usually create a MDX assertion.
Q26. How To Set Up Aggregate Awareness?
To use aggregate cognizance, first the aggregated table has to be loaded to database after which add the table to Data Foundation.
Define mixture aware gadgets. These are objects in the enterprise layer for which you need queries to apply the combination tables while possible rather than appearing aggregation using non-combination tables.
In the SQL expression for the item, define the SELECT declaration to apply the @Aggregate_Aware function −
@Aggregate_Aware(sum(aggr_table_1), …, sum(aggr_table_n))
Q27. When You Convert A Unv File To Unx Files, Which Of The Features Are Not Supported?
In IDT, it doesn’t convert OLAP universes created with previous releases. It is suggested to make a connection to OLAP source to take dimensional modeling benefits.
You can’t convert universes based totally on stored approaches the use of IDT.
Using IDT, you could convert linked universes but they're no longer supported in BI four.
Q28. What Are The Different Data Connections That Are Supported In Dashboard Designer?
In SAP Dashboard Designer, under statistics connections are supported −
Query as a Web provider (QWAAS)
Web Service Connection
SAP NetWeaver BW connection
XML Data
Crystal Report Data Consumer
Live cycle Data Services
External Interface Connection
Live Office Connections
Web Dynpro utility as Flash Island
Q29. What Is Chasm Trap? How Do You Resolve This?
When you join a measurement desk with truth tables with one to many courting, whilst you drag a measurement along side measure from each the reality tables, price of measures are inflated. This is referred to as Chasm lure.
This may be solved the use of Context with the aid of developing exclusive contexts.
Other way is to visit Universe parameters and pick out the check box → Multiple SQL statements for each degree
Q30. What Are The Different Access Levels Of An Object? Where Do You Define Access Level?
You can outline various get entry to levels of an object −
Private
Public
Controlled
Restricted
Confidential
When you outline an item as public, all users can get right of entry to the object. If an item is defined as limited, users that are granted access degree of constrained or higher can get right of entry to. To define get right of entry to stage of items −
Select the object in Business layer for that you want to outline the get admission to degree. You can use CTRL key to pick more than one objects. Right click on item → Change Access Level.
Q31. If You Want To Use Same Layout, Appearance For All The Data Models In Dashboard Designer, How You Can Do This?
Using subject matters, you could observe identical format, look and formatting to facts models whilst you want all fashions with equal look. Theme offers you with a color scheme but you may customize it as according to requirement.
To apply a subject matter, go to Format → Theme
Q32. What Is A Container Component? What Are The Different Types Of Container?
Container aspect may be nested to create multilayer models. You can use canvas container inside fundamental canvas to preserve one or extra additives. You can upload, move, delete or trade additives in panel container.
You can use different sorts of bins −
Panel Container
Tab Set
Q33. When You Perform A Conversion In Umt, Unv Files Are Converted To Unx Files?
File extension remains equal whilst you run over in UMT. You want to perform a conversion in IDT to trade document extension from unv to unx.
Q34. What Is Query Refresh Or Query Prompt Under Universe Component?
These components can be used with queries on Universe.
Query Refresh Button: This permits person to refresh the statistics at runtime. You can encompass Universe or BEX query to allow users to request a query refresh at run time.
Query Prompt Selector: This allows user to select values from BEX or Universe question activates at run time. As consistent with prompt type, consumer can pick out a single cost to use as filter out parameter or can select choice objects.
Q35. What Is Personal, Public And Secured Connection?
A Personal connection is described as created by one consumer and can not be used by other users.
A shared connection may be used by different users via a shared server. You can’t submit a Universe to repository using a shared connection.
A secured connection overcomes the above limitations and you can use this to export Universe to the primary repository.
Q36. How Can You Add Data From A Universe/idt To Dashboard?
Using query browser, you can click on on Add question → Universe as information source
Select the published Universe and to feature gadgets, you can use Query panel.
When question is delivered, you can do mapping of objects to spreadsheet and later to Dashboard additives.
Q37. Is It Possible To Link A Webi Report To A Dashboard? How?
You can post Webi file block as a BI provider and may be consumed without delay in Dashboard.
Q38. What Are The Different States In Context?
In a context, there are 3 states described for a Join −
Included joins − In part of the schema this is ambiguous, the context solves the loop via defining a course with the blanketed joins.
Excluded joins − In part of the schema this is ambiguous, the excluded joins outline the path that context will in no way take.
Neutral joins are in part of the schema that is not ambiguous, and are usually included inside the query route of the context. Any be a part of that isn't explicitly included or excluded is impartial.
A Context may be described manually or by means of clicking stumble on Context alternative.
Q39. How Would You Connect Sap Ecc System To Dashboard Designer?
There are exceptional methods −
You can use SLT technique for information replication to HANA and then create a Universe on the top of HANA database. Universe may be consumed in Dashboard the usage of question browser.
You can immediately create a Universe at the pinnacle of transaction gadget.
Using brief provider, you could join ECC to load records to BW and question browser may be used to connect with BW.
Q40. What Is The Difference Between A Cnx And Cns File?
.Cns - secured Repository connection
.Cnx - local unsecured connection. If you operate this connection it's going to no longer allow you to publish something to repository.
Q41. Where Do You Define Behavior, Insertion And General Properties Of A Component?
Select the element → proper click Properties tab
On proper facet, you get options to define diverse properties of a element in dashboard model.
Q42. What Is Repository Dependency On An Object In A Local Project?
To see dependent sources in Repository for a specific useful resource beneath Local task, right click and click on display Repository Dependency.
Enter the consultation info wherein sources are posted and click on on log in. It will show you listing of posted Universes in repository which might be primarily based on decided on useful resource underneath Local Project.
Q43. What Is Information Design Tool? Which All Reporting And Dashboard Tools You Have Used With Idt?
IDT is called Business Objects design device that extracts the statistics from one-of-a-kind information assets using an OLAP and Relational connection to create Universes. There are different Universe parameters that can be handed at time of Universe advent.
It can be utilized in under reporting and dashboard tools −
SAP Business Objects Web Intelligence (WebI)
SAP Business Objects Dashboard Designer (Earlier known as Xcelsius)
SAP Business Objects Crystal Reports
SAP Business Objects Explorer
Q44. What Are The Different Dashboard Versions You Have Worked On?
BOXI 3.1 well matched Dashboard is referred to as Xcelsius two hundred@
BOXI four.Zero well suited Dashboard is known as Dashboard 4.@
BOXI 4.1 well matched Dashboard is referred to as Dashboard 4.@
Q45. What Is Fan Trap? How Do You Resolve This?
In a Universe, when you have three tables in shape and primary desk is joined with one to many dating with 2nd table which is linked with one to many relationship with 0.33 table and while you drag a measure from 2nd desk and measurement from 3rd table, value of measure is inflated, this situation is called Fan entice.
You can clear up this by using creating an alias of the 2d desk and defining contexts so that ordinary table is joined most effective with the first desk, while the alias is joined with each the 1st and the 3rd table. We would take second table’s degree most effective from the everyday desk and other dimensions of the 2nd desk from the alias desk.
Q46. To Insert Large Amount Of Data In Dashboard Designer, We Can Use Spreadsheet To Map The Objects From Query?
Spreadsheets are favored whilst the wide variety of rows are less in Dashboard. It is by default set to 512 rows however you may edit this putting via going to Preferences.
Q47. What Is Index Awareness?
Index cognizance in a Universe determines which values in a clear out conditions of the queries constructed from the universe, are changed by means of their corresponding indexes or surrogate keys. Values in filter comes from dimensions desk and you want a join with the reality table to get this price.
Q48. Have You Heard About Design Studio? How It Is Different From Dashboard Designer?
Chart Types: There are 22 charts of sixteen types-34 charts of 12 sorts
Selectors: 18 Selectors of 16 sorts-10 Selectors of 10 Types
Containers: 7 Containers of 3 Types-5 Container of five Types
Maps: For one hundred Countries-No Maps
Calendar: Calendar is available as desk-Calendar is available as enter discipline
Filter Panel: No filter Panel-Drilling and Filtering Capabilities
What-If Component: 6 components-No additives
Visualization Engine: Adobe Flash with HTML5 assist-Native HTML with CSS
Design and Color Schemes: Multiple subject matters, personalize the usage of GUI-Basic themes, custom designed using CSS

